Maasai Nborr Collar

jewelry · Kenya · East Africa

The nborr is the flat beaded collar worn by Maasai women and, on ceremonial occasions, by young men (moran) of Kenya and Tanzania. Built on a base of hide or wire and covered with dense rows of tiny glass beads, the collar forms a broad crescent that lies across the chest and shoulders. The colour combinations are not arbitrary: red stands for the cattle that are the heart of Maasai life, white for milk and peace, and the patterns signal the age-set, clan, and status of the wearer.
